Authors report that their data suggest that c.464A>G is a Turkish founder mutation.; to: PMID:30345904 reported a Sudanese patient of Arab descent identified with homozygous variant (p.Asn155Ser) in PYROXD1 gene and presented with limb-girdle-type muscular dystrophy (LGMD). The variant was present in heterozygous state in unaffected sister, unaffected son and unaffected daughter and absent in unaffected brother.

PMID:30515627 reported four patients from three Finnish families with biallelic variants (three with homozygous p.Asn155Ser variant and one with compound heterozygous p.Asn155Ser/ p.Tyr354Cys variants). All of them presented with an adult-onset slowly-progressive LGMD phenotype of symmetric muscle weakness and wasting.

PMID:33694278 reported three patients from two consanguineous Turkish families with biallelic variants (homozygous missense variant (p.Asn155Ser) in family 1 with two affected females and compound heterozygous variants (p.Asn155Ser/ p.Leu112Valfs*8) in affected male of family 2). They presented with mild LGMD, facial weakness, normal CK levels, and slow progress. Authors report that their data suggest that c.464A>G is a Turkish founder mutation.

This gene has not yet been associated with LGMD either in OMIM or in Gene2Phenotype.

Added comment: Reported in >3 families, but phenotype varies from early onset myopathy to a later, more LGMD-like presentation. Recurring variant, Asn155ser, identified in multiple families of different ethnicity. Age of onset variable between families. Mostly normal CK levels PMID: 30345904: 1 family reported with Asn155Ser variant. Normal CK level. Progressive muscle weakness began at the age of 9. PMID: 30515627: 3 Finnish families reported, Asn155Ser, reported on at least one allele. Patients presented with LGMD-type phenotype, onset >20. EMG showed myopathic changes. Normal CK levels. PMID: 27745833: 5 families reported (includes 2 consang Turkish families, hom Asn155Ser). Authors concluded gene as causative for early-onset myopathy, normal to moderately elevated CK levels. EMG was myopathic in all individuals tested
